CAS 27387-23-1
:2-(2-bromo-5-methoxyphenyl)acetonitrile
Description:
2-(2-Bromo-5-methoxyphenyl)acetonitrile, with the CAS number 27387-23-1, is an organic compound characterized by its structure, which includes a brominated aromatic ring and a nitrile functional group. This compound features a bromo substituent at the 2-position and a methoxy group at the 5-position of a phenyl ring, contributing to its unique chemical properties. The presence of the acetonitrile group indicates that it contains a cyano functional group (-C≡N), which is known for its reactivity and ability to participate in various chemical reactions, such as nucleophilic additions. The methoxy group can influence the compound's electronic properties, potentially enhancing its reactivity in electrophilic aromatic substitution reactions. Additionally, the bromine atom can serve as a leaving group in substitution reactions. This compound may be of interest in medicinal chemistry and organic synthesis due to its potential applications in the development of pharmaceuticals or as an intermediate in chemical reactions. As with many organic compounds, safety and handling precautions should be observed due to its chemical nature.
Formula:C9H8BrNO
Synonyms:- 5-Methoxy-2-Bromophenylacetonitrile
- Benzeneacetonitrile,2-Bromo-5-Methoxy
